Test Procedure. The aggregates crushing value test should be performed as per IS code 2386 Part IV. First, fill the sample aggregate with onethird of the cylindrical measure in three layers. Each layer should be tamped 25times freely. After filling the sample aggregate, weigh and record it as W1.
11/11/2019 · Crushed stone often has an angular and jagged edge that occurs during the crushing process. Gravel, on the other hand, typically has a very smooth texture and surface because of the natural weathering and wear of being exposed to the effects of running water.

· Particle size distribution curves of recycled aggregates from building demolition concrete crushed by jaw and impact crushers. The jaw crusher produced 60% of coarse aggregates in weight, whereas the impact crusher produced 49% coarse aggregates. The proportion of particles finer than mm is around 7–8% weight for both crushing mechanisms.

Gold ore concentration process. The Crushing Sections: The gold ore from the mine site is always with size 0400mm or 0600mm after blasting. We use the crushing plant to crush the raw gold ore into 08 or 010mm. Primary Grinding and Classifying Section: The gold ore with the size 08mm or 010mm will be fed into the ball mill.

26/04/2018 · Calculation of aggregate crushing value. The aggregate crushing value is defined as the ratio of the weight of fines passing through specified IS (here sieve) to the total weight of sample expressed in percentage. W1= Weigh of the total aggregates (WaWe) W2= Weigh of aggregates passing through IS sieve.
The most important parameters associated with recycled concrete aggregate (RCA) production that may affect quality and yield include such properties of the parent concrete as the composition, strength and aggregate grading, type of crushers used, number of crushing stages, the size of the RCA particles, and the size reduction sequence.

Crushed aggregate is produced in quarries by processing larger rocks into smaller pieces. Crushed aggregate, also known as rock aggregate, refers to a crushed stone product produced in quarries. In areas where natural sand and gravel aggregate deposits are insufficient to handle local demand, larger stones are processed in an impact crusher to create crushed rock aggregate.
